The Art of Tafqeet and Professional Conversion

In financial and legal domains, writing numbers as words is a critical anti-fraud measure. Known in the Arab world as Tafqeet, this process ensures that numerical figures cannot be easily altered by adding digits. Our professional-grade converter handles linguistic rules to produce clear text for both English and Arabic.

Why Accuracy Matters in Arabic

Arabic Tafqeet is notoriously complex because it must respect gender (Masculine/Feminine), dual forms, and plural rules (Tamyiz). For example, the way we write "pounds" changes if there are 2, 5, or 100. This tool encodes these linguistic rules to ensure every invoice you generate is both legal and visually professional.
